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| Forest Rocket Frog | Northern Treeshrew |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om same | Animalia (Animals) | Animalia (Animals) |
| Phylum same | Chordata (Chordates) | Chordata (Chordates) |
| Class | Amphibia (Amphibians) | Mammalia (Mammals) |
| Order | Anura (Frogs & Toads) | Scandentia (Scandentia) |
| Family | Aromobatidae | Tupaiidae |
| Genus | Aromobates | Tupaia |
| Species | Aromobates saltuensis | Tupaia belangeri |
Evolutionary Relationship
Forest Rocket Frog and Northern Treeshrew share a common ancestor at the Phylum level: Chordata. (Chordates)

Habitat & Geographic Range
Forest Rocket Frog
Habitat
Typically found in freshwater habitats, moist forests, and wetlands.
Range
Found in Venezuela. Currently classified as Endangered on the IUCN Red List, this species faces significant conservation challenges across its range.
